Best Robot Vacuums and Mop Combos

A robot cleaner with mop vacuum is the best device to keep a clean home. It will pick up dust, pet hair and other surface debris.

2. Eufy RoboVac Hybrid X8

While the Anker-owned Eufy has made an impact in low-cost robot vacuums it's not yet an all-in-one model which can also mop. The X8 Hybrid is a new model that has a wide range of features that are advanced and can compete with more expensive models.

The main selling point of Eufy's this machine is its laser navigation. Previous Eufy devices have constructed an approximate map of your home using infrared sensors and bumping into objects, but the X8's laser mapping technology is far more precise. It takes less time to build an accurate map of your home. It also has the ability to store multiple maps. This is perfect for multi-floored homes.

The X8 is a good vacuum cleaner on bare floors. It can easily sling debris under the side brushes and into its 400ml dust bin. Its tyres are adept at hugging edges and corners despite being circular. It's not the best robot cleaner and mop cat litter picker, though as our tests show it only removes about 90 percent of the fur off hard floors.

The mopping mode that is the basic one uses the same reservoir of water as the vacuuming mode. While this is a good option for spills that aren't too big however, you aren't able to limit the amount of water it uses which can limit its effectiveness when dealing with more severe stains. It's effective of removing hair from pets. It has a higher rate of pick-up than the Roborock S7.

4. Shark ION

This budget-friendly robovac looks just like a typical robot, but it's a step up in performance and features. Its smart mapping system creates 3D and 2-D maps of your house and uses them to navigate around and avoid obstructions. It's also able to detect common obstacles like furniture legs and power cords in real time. The combination of sensors with a bump detector and an infrared sensor to keep the vacuum off steps makes it one our most agile vacuums.

In our tests, it effortlessly climbed over thick shag rug and didn't end up stuck on them (like the RoboVac 11s or Roomba 690). Its navigation skills were impressive as well and its overall score on carpet and bare floors was better than the competition and it took in 98.5 percent of surface litter and embedded pet hair from our lab test samples.

The controls are more basic than those of the competitors. There's an oblong cleaning button at the top. You can access it via the app or via voice commands using Alexa or Google Assistant. You can also set a schedule for weekly or daily cleaning, set no-go zones, and see its cleaning history. Covered in stylish dark gray plastics, Ion feels sturdy and looks attractive in your home. The rear dust bin is easy to empty and cleaning the filter is just as simple.

5. Eufy 11S

If you're looking to buy a basic robotic vacuum that is simple and has no frills at a reasonable cost, the Eufy 11S is a great option. It doesn't have many of the more advanced features, like digital mapping and Alexa integration, which are available in more expensive models, however, if you don't require those functions you can save a little money with this model.

The robot is simple to use and set up. It doesn't require smartphone application or Wi-Fi pairing. However it does include the remote control that allows you to choose between different modes and alter the suction level. You can also manually set the robotvac to an cleaning schedule.

In our tests during our tests, the 11S was very effective at cleaning dirt and pet hair from hard floors as well as in carpets with low pile. Its slim profile allowed it to fit under furniture with low hanging and other objects that larger robots are unable to reach. It could also easily pass over doorway thresholds and transition between floors and another.

The 11S, as with other robots will also suckup certain objects, like cords and cat toys. The manufacturer says that you can prevent this by keeping these objects off the floor and by using an organizer for cords if you can. It also suggests that you periodically clean the dustbin, replace the filters and change or wash the brushes when needed.

6. iRobot Roomba 980

The Roomba 980 is iRobot's flagship robot vacuum. It's costly, but it's top-performing and is arguably the most sophisticated robot vacuum you can buy. Its self-navigating features and environmental mapping are truly a marvel to behold. It also has more advanced automation features than its competitors, such as the ability to set virtual boundary lines through its mobile application. Although the app is a little sluggish and the 980 can spin out a bit when moving over cables, it's still a very capable robot vacuum.

We really like the 980 because it uses its iAdapt2.0 navigation sensors and visual simultaneity mapping and localisation (or vSLAM), to memorise your home's floor plan. It will use this information to create a consistent, efficient cleaning path in every cycle. The result is cleaner floors, and a more efficient vacuum than other high-end robot vacuums.

Other features of the 980 include two multi-surface rubber brushes which pick up dirt from carpet and hard floors, along with an ejector brush that moves debris into the bin of the robotic vacuum. The sensors for floor tracking help it navigate across furniture and along edges, while Cliff Detect keeps the Roomba from slipping down stairs. It also automatically returns to its base station for easy recharges between sessions. The bin capacity and battery life of the 980 aren't as good as some other robot vacuums. However, it is a solid and reliable machine that will keep floors clean for many hours.
